Transaction 58d72f7629e599833c4c349790705b05df91811190bfc33cb9e0cef74db280ba

1 Input
2 Outputs
  • 58d72f7629e599833c4c349790705b05df91811190bfc33cb9e0cef74db280ba:0
  • value  88358
    address  19kuphAC4MtVbJUDiBzQ6BibnhCUThswGz
  • 58d72f7629e599833c4c349790705b05df91811190bfc33cb9e0cef74db280ba:1
  • value  188116
    address  1EP2g4JoGEn3e7GbahCnSnzfhguT5W8aw2